*** a/contrib/postgres_fdw/postgres_fdw.c
--- b/contrib/postgres_fdw/postgres_fdw.c
***************
*** 185,190 **** typedef struct PgFdwModifyState
--- 185,194 ----
/* working memory context */
MemoryContext temp_cxt; /* context for per-tuple temporary data */
+
+ /* for update row movement, if subplan resultrel */
+ struct PgFdwModifyState *aux_fmstate; /* foreign-insert state, if
+ * created */
} PgFdwModifyState;
/*
***************
*** 1844,1851 **** postgresExecForeignInsert(EState *estate,
TupleTableSlot *slot,
TupleTableSlot *planSlot)
{
! return execute_foreign_modify(estate, resultRelInfo, CMD_INSERT,
slot, planSlot);
}
/*
--- 1848,1871 ----
TupleTableSlot *slot,
TupleTableSlot *planSlot)
{
! PgFdwModifyState *fmstate = (PgFdwModifyState *) res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State;
! TupleTableSlot *rslot;
!
! /*
! * If the fmstate has aux_fmstate set, it means the foreign table is an
! * UPDATE subplan resultrel, in which case, the aux_fmstate is provided
! * for the INSERT operation on the table, whereas the fmstate is provided
! * for the UPDATE operation on the table; use the aux_fmstate
! */
! if (fmstate->aux_fmstate)
! res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State = fmstate->aux_fmstate;
! rslot = execute_foreign_modify(estate, resultRelInfo, CMD_INSERT,
slot, planSlot);
+ /* Revert that change */
+ if (fmstate->aux_fmstate)
+ res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State = fmstate;
+
+ return rslot;
}
/*
***************
*** 1917,1922 **** postgresBeginForeignInsert(ModifyTableState *mtstate,
--- 1937,1959 ----
initStringInfo(&sql);
+ /*
+ * If the foreign table is an UPDATE subplan resultrel that hasn't yet
+ * been updated, routing tuples to the table might yield incorrect
+ * results, because if routing tuples, routed tuples will be mistakenly
+ * read from the table and updated twice when updating the table --- it
+ * would be nice if we could handle this case; but for now, throw an error
+ * for safety.
+ */
+ if (plan && plan->operation == CMD_UPDATE &&
+ (resultRelInfo->ri_usesFdwDirectModify ||
+ res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State) &&
+ resultRelInfo > mtstate->resultRelInfo + mtstate->mt_whichplan)
+ ereport(ERROR,
+ (errcode(ERRCODE_FEATURE_NOT_SUPPORTED),
+ errmsg("cannot route tuples into foreign table to be updated \"%s\"",
+ RelationGetRelationName(rel))));
+
/* We transmit all columns that are defined in the foreign table. */
for (attnum = 1; attnum <= tupdesc->natts; attnum++)
{
***************
*** 1983,1989 **** postgresBeginForeignInsert(ModifyTableState *mtstate,
retrieved_attrs != NIL,
retrieved_attrs);
! res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State = fmstate;
}
/*
--- 2020,2038 ----
retrieved_attrs != NIL,
retrieved_attrs);
! /*
! * If the given resultRelInfo already has PgFdwModifyState set, it means
! * the foreign table is an UPDATE subplan resultrel; in which case, store
! * the resulting state into the aux_fmstate of the PgFdwModifyState.
! */
! if (res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State)
! {
! Assert(plan && plan->operation == CMD_UPDATE);
! Assert(resultRelInfo->ri_usesFdwDirectModify == false);
! ((PgFdwModifyState *) res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State)->aux_fmstate = fmstate;
! }
! else
! resultRelInfo->ri_FdwState = fmstate;
}
/*
***************
*** 1998,2003 **** postgresEndForeignInsert(EState *estate,
--- 2047,2061 ----
Assert(fmstate != NULL);
+ /*
+ * If the fmstate has aux_fmstate set, it means the foreign table is an
+ * UPDATE subplan resultrel, in which case, the aux_fmstate is provided
+ * for the INSERT operation on the table, whereas the fmstate is provided
+ * for the UPDATE operation on the table; get the aux_fmstate
+ */
+ if (fmstate->aux_fmstate)
+ fmstate = fmstate->aux_fmstate;
+
/* Destroy the execution state */
finish_foreign_modify(fmstate);
}
***************
*** 3482,3487 **** create_foreign_modify(EState *estate,
--- 3540,3548 ----
Assert(fmstate->p_nums <= n_params);
+ /* Initialize auxiliary state */
+ fmstate->aux_fmstate = NULL;
+
return fmstate;
}
